Cosmetics refers to the act of applying cosmetics (cosmetics) to the human body and decorating them finely. The cosmetics used for such cosmetics are mainly makeup cosmetics used for skin and point makeup cosmetics used for eyes, eyebrows and lips .

The makeup cosmetics are used to enhance the impression with eye shadow, mascara, eye line, lipstick, lip gloss and the like, while point makeup cosmetics are used to enhance the impression with the powder, the foundation or the ball touch, .

However, when these cosmetic products are applied directly to the body parts by the user's hands, there was the inconvenience of washing the cosmetic products on the hands after applying the cosmetic products, and there was a problem that the amount of cosmetics to be washed was wasted, There was difficulty in delicately expressing the application site.

Therefore, cosmetic tools are used to easily and easily apply cosmetics to the skin. In the case of cosmetics in the form of powder such as powder and eye shadow, and solid cosmetics such as liquid cosmetics such as lip gloss and mascara and lipsticks, Various types of cosmetic tools are used to suit each application and characteristic.

Various forms such as a brush, a brush, a pad, a tip, a pen, and a puff are used as the above-mentioned makeup tools. Among them, puffs have a wide area reaching the application area, And the tip is mainly used to draw the contours of the lips or the outline of the eyes.

However, the above-mentioned make-up tools are separately provided or housed in the cosmetic container, and it is troublesome for the user to use the one hand with the cosmetic tool while the other hand needs to discharge the cosmetic.

In addition, since the container for accommodating the cosmetics and the makeup tool for applying the cosmetics are separated from each other, it is not possible to place the makeup tool in the case of outdoor use, and the makeup tool that directly touches the skin is directly touched by the contaminated hand, .

In order to solve the above problems, Korean Patent Laid-Open Publication No. 10-0915595 discloses a puff-integrated cosmetic tube container as shown in FIG. 1. This prior art has a tube body 1 with an opened bottom, A coupling member 2 is coupled to a lower portion of the tube body 1 and a puff coupling plate 3 is coupled to a lower portion of the coupling member 2 and a separate cap (5) protruding downward and a discharge pipe (6) protruding toward the center of the inside of the guide part (5) are formed on the fastening member (2) A guide pipe 7 into which the discharge pipe 6 is inserted and a puff attaching plate 3 attached to a bottom surface of the puff coupling plate 3, 8).

However, in the case of eye make-up or lip make-up, the makeup is made with a wide-shaped applicator and then the outline of the make-up area is drawn with a sharp-pointed applicator. In the prior art, The puffs 8 are difficult to express the contour of the application area delicately. In order to draw the outline of the makeup area, a separate application member is required to be used.

As shown in FIG. 2, a tube-shaped cosmetic container having a double discharge means is disclosed in Korean Patent Registration No. 10-1363349. In the prior art, the contents are accommodated, A body 12 coupled to an upper portion of the container body 10 and a nozzle 12 communicating with the discharge portion 11 and extending upward in a central portion of the body 12, 13 and a rotating body 16 rotatably coupled to the upper portion of the nozzle unit 15. The nozzle unit 15 is moved upward and downward by the rotation of the rotating body 16 to move the nozzle 13 And a lifting member (18) having a discharge member (17) for absorbing the contents discharged through the nozzle (13) while being hidden or exposed.

However, according to the above-mentioned prior art, the shape of the application member may be changed according to the user's selection, so that the cosmetic product can be easily applied to the wide and narrow portions of the face with the modified application member. However, The cosmetics flowing into the space between the nozzle 13 and the lifting and lowering member 18 hardened and the rotating body 16 could not rotate smoothly.

As the elliptical rotary body 16 rotatably coupled to the upper portion of the nozzle unit 15 rotates, the elliptical rising and descending member 18 on the inner side thereof is rotated together with the nozzle unit 15, When the rotating body 16 and the lifting and lowering member 18 are cylindrically shaped, they are loose at the time of rotation. Therefore, in the case of the thin cylindrical type cosmetic container of the pen type, There is a problem that it can not be applied.

An embodiment of a cosmetic container provided with a coating member whose shape is changed according to the present invention will be described with reference to the accompanying drawings.

FIG. 3 is a perspective view of a cosmetic container having an applicator according to an embodiment of the present invention, FIG. 4 is a cross-sectional view of a cosmetic container having an applicator in which the shape of the container is changed according to an embodiment of the present invention. It is a perspective view. FIG. 5 is a cross-sectional view of a cosmetic container having an applicator according to an embodiment of the present invention, FIG. 6 is a cross-sectional view of a cosmetic container having an applicator for changing the shape according to an embodiment of the present invention Fig. FIG. 7 is a partial perspective view of a state in which the second applicator of the cosmetic container is lowered according to an embodiment of the present invention, and FIG. 8 is a cross- Fig. 6 is a perspective view showing a state in which the second application member of the cosmetic container provided with the application member descends.

The rotary guide cap 40 includes a container body 20 having a receiving space formed therein, a rotation guide cap 40 coupled to the container body 20 and formed with a rotation guide slit 41, A rotation cap 60 coupled to the outer periphery of the rotation guide cap 40 and having an upper and lower guide groove 61 formed on an inner peripheral surface thereof, A second coating member 80 coupled to the vertical movement cap 50 and a lid 90 coupled to the rotation cap 60. The first coating member 70 is fixedly coupled to the rotary cap 20, The lifting protrusion 51 of the up and down movement cap 50 is fitted into the rotation guide slit 41 of the rotation guide cap 40 and positioned in the upper and lower guide grooves 61 of the rotation cap 60.

The container body 20 includes a container 21 and an outer container 23. A plate 22 is formed in the container 21 and an air hole 211 is formed in the bottom.

The sealing member 35 of the discharge pump 30 is fitted to the upper end of the container 21 and the plate 22 is coupled to the inside of the container 21, The contents are then pushed upward to be discharged.

An air hole 211 is formed in the lower portion of the content container 21 and air is introduced into the air hole 211 to smoothly raise the plate 22.

The outer container (23) is coupled to the inner container (21) with a bottom open.

The outer container 23 has an opening 24 formed at an upper end thereof and a discharge pump 30 coupled with the container 21 is coupled to the opening 24.

The lower end surface of the outer container 23 is formed with an oblique incision surface 25 which is obliquely cut.

The diagonal cut-off surface 25 is formed in such a manner that when the content container 21 having the discharge pump 30 is coupled to the inside of the outer container 23 to discharge the contents contained in the container 21, And serves to press the container 21 smoothly.

The discharge pump 30 is mounted inside the container 21 of the container body 20 to discharge the contents of the container 21 to the outside.

The discharge pump 30 includes a piston 33, a cylinder 31 into which the piston 33 is inserted, a piston ring 34 installed between the outer circumferential surface of the piston 33 and the inner circumferential surface of the cylinder 31, A check valve 32 formed at a lower portion of the cylinder 31, a sealing member 35 fastened to the upper portion of the cylinder 31, an elevating member 37 coupled to the inside of the sealing member 35, And an elastic member 36 formed between the sealing member 37 and the sealing member 35.

The cylinder 31 has a second inlet 311 for receiving the contents contained in the container 21 of the container body 20 and a lower portion of the cylinder 31 through which the piston 33 fitted with the piston ring 34 is inserted. .

A check valve 32 is provided in the second inlet 311 of the cylinder 31 to prevent the contents flowing into the cylinder 31 from flowing back toward the container body 20.

A hollow 331 is formed in the piston 33. A blocking wall 334 is formed on the lower side of the hollow 331 and a side wall of the first inlet 331 And a flange 333 is formed at the lower end.

A sealing member 35 is fastened to the upper portion of the piston 33 and an elevating member 37 communicating with the hollow 331 of the piston 33 is integrally assembled to the inside of the sealing member 35, As the elevating member 37 moves up and down, the piston 33 also moves up and down.

The piston ring 34 is fitted to the outer circumferential surface of the piston 33 and disposed on the flange 333 of the piston 33. Therefore, as the piston 33 descends, a clearance is formed between the flange 333 of the piston 33 and the piston ring 34, so that a content discharge passage is formed. When the piston 33 rises, 33 are brought into close contact with the piston ring 34 to close the contents discharge passage.

The sealing member 35 is fitted inside the cylinder 31 to increase the airtightness of the discharge pump 30 and the upper end of the container 21 is fitted.

The elastic member 36 is located between the elevating member 37 and the sealing member 35 so that the elevating member 37 is positioned between the sealing member 35 and the cylinder 31. [ 37).

The lifting member 37 is fitted to the outside of the piston 33 and the contents discharged through the hollow 331 pass through the inside of the lifting member 37 and are discharged.

The rotation guide cap 40 is coupled to an upper end of the container 23 outside the container body 20 and a rotation guide slit 41 is formed.

The rotation guide slit 41 is formed in an oblique shape and a lifting protrusion 51 of the vertical movement cap 50 inserted into the guide pipe 20 is positioned.

A vertical movement cap (50) is coupled to the inside of the rotation guide cap (40).

The up-and-down movement cap (50) is provided with a lifting protrusion (51) on the outer circumferential surface thereof and a locking impeller (52) formed thereon.

The lifting and lowering protrusion 51 passes through the rotation guide slit 41 of the rotation guide cap 40 and is fitted into the upper and lower guide grooves 61 of the rotation cap 60 to move up and down.

The second coating member 80 is engaged with the engaging wheel 52 to prevent the second coating member 80 from being detached.

The rotary cap 60 is coupled to the outer side of the rotation guide cap 40 and the upper and lower guide grooves 61 are formed on the inner peripheral surface thereof.

The lifting protrusion 51 of the up and down movement cap 50 protruding through the rotation guide slit 41 of the rotation guide cap 40 is fitted into the upper and lower guide grooves 61 to rotate the rotation cap 60 The lifting and lowering projection 51 of the up-and-down moving cap 50 moves up and down within the rotation guide cap 40.

The first coating member 70 has a first through hole 71 penetrating the first coating member 70 and a fastening protrusion 72 formed on an outer circumferential surface thereof and a lower extension portion 73 formed below the fastening protrusion 72.

The first through hole 71 is a passage through which the contents passing through the discharge pump 30 move.

The hooking protrusion 72 contacts the upper end of the opening 24 of the container 23 outside the container body 20 and the lower extension portion 73 formed below the hooking protrusion 72 is inserted into the opening 24, And fixes the first application member 70 to the container body 20.

The first coating member 70 passes through the vertical movement cap 50 and the second through hole 81 of the second coating member 80.

The second coating member 80 is formed with a dome-shaped coating surface, and a second through hole 81 through which the first coating member 70 passes is formed at the center thereof and a hooking tooth 82 is formed inside the lower end thereof .

When the up-and-down movement cap 50 is moved up and down as the engagement protrusion 82 is engaged with the engagement protrusion 52 of the up-and-down movement cap 50 and fixed to the up-and-down movement cap 50, The member 80 also moves up and down.

The second coating member 80 may be made of at least one material selected from the group consisting of butadiene rubber, styrene butadiene rubber (SBR), nylon rubber, wet urethane, dry urethane, polyether, polyester, polyvinyl chloride, polyethylene, EVA And at least one material selected from the group consisting of latex, silicone, SIS (Styrene Isoprene Styrene), SEBS (Styrene Ethylene Butylene Styrene), PVA (Polyvinyl Alcohol), silicone elastomer, nitrile rubber, butyl rubber and neoprene can do.

A lid 90 is further coupled to prevent contamination of the second applicator member 80.

The method of assembling and using the cosmetic container provided with the application member of which shape is changed according to one embodiment of the present invention will be described in detail as follows.

A discharge pump (30) is mounted on the upper end of a container (21) in which a plate (22) is mounted in order to assemble a cosmetic container provided with a coating member whose shape is changed, Fitted to the upper end of the container (21).

Thereafter, the content container 21 is inserted into the lower end of the outer container 23 so that the lifting member 37 of the discharge pump 30 coupled to the container 21 is inserted into the opening 24 of the outer container 23 ) To the inside.

The first coating member 70 is fixedly coupled to the opening 24 while the lower extension portion 73 of the first coating member 70 is fitted into the opening 24 and the engaging jaw 72 is inserted into the opening 24, The first application member 70 is fixedly coupled to the opening 24 of the outer container 23 of the container body 20 by placing the first application member 70 on the upper end of the opening 24.

Thereafter, a rotation guide cap 40 having a rotation guide slit 41 formed at an upper end of the outer container 23 is coupled to the rotation guide cap 40, and a vertical movement cap (not shown) 50, the elevation protrusion 51 is coupled to the rotation guide slit 41 in a protruding manner.

The upper and lower guide rails 51 of the upper and lower movable caps 50 are inserted into the upper and lower guide grooves 61 so that the upper and lower guide grooves 61 are formed on the outer peripheral surface of the rotation guide cap 40, .

The second coating member 80 is engaged with the vertically movable cap 50 by engaging the engagement projection 82 of the second coating member 80 with the engagement projection wheel 52 formed on the upper portion of the vertical movement cap 50, .

In order to prevent the second coating member 80 from being contaminated, the lid 90 is engaged to complete the assembly.

6, when the lower end of the container 21 is pressurized, the discharge pump 30 is pressurized and the container body 20 is pressurized. As a result, The contents accommodated in the container 21 of the container 21 are discharged. At this time, the container 22 is pressed up by the vacuum pressure.

When the lower end of the container 21 is pressed, the container 21 can be pressed smoothly due to the oblique incision 25 formed at the lower end of the container 23.

As shown in FIG. 6, the content of the content container 21 is discharged and a wide portion is coated using the second coating member 80.

7, the rotating cap 60 is rotated so that the lifting protrusion 51 of the up-and-down moving cap 50 is rotated in the direction of the rotation guide slit 41 of the rotating guide cap 40. As a result, The second application member 80 engaged with the engagement protrusion 52 of the up-and-down movement cap 50 is also moved downward.

As shown in FIG. 8, the first coating member 70 is exposed to the outside as the second coating member 80 moves.

The first coating member 70 and the second coating member 80 may have different shapes and may be used by the user. If a large surface is to be coated, the second coating member 80, which is formed as shown in FIG. 3, As shown in FIG. 8, the first coating member 70, which is narrowly formed, can be exposed to the outside, so that it is not necessary to provide a coating member having a different shape. The first coating member 70 having the through holes 71 is formed so as to protrude upward while passing through the center of the vertical movement cap 50 so that the discharge port of the first coating member 70 is rotated by the rotation cap 60, There is an effect of preventing the content discharged from the discharge port from flowing between the rotation guide cap 40 and the vertical movement cap 50 and hardening by separating the guide cap 40 and the vertical movement cap 50 from each other.
